Postby Di & Sean » Wed May 05, 2010 8:44 am

Good morning all from a little cloudy Elenite,
A few clouds this morning, sea like a mill pond, temperature's mild, sun trying to come out. Yesterday another hot one, soaked up the sun and a few drinks at Robo's late afternoon. Amazing, people actually in the sea, brrrh a bit cold for me. Pool at Taliana also full and ready to go and getting used by the few tourist that are here. Big holiday in Bulgaria tomorrow for St George's day, also Pomorie day. Pomorie day, one of the biggest events, plenty of street partying, food stalls, fair rides, well worth a visit. We shall be venturing down to join in the fun and have a few drinks for abscent friends. Such good fun last year, still chuckling at the memories. :wink: Have a good day all.
